What Are Architectural Roofing Shingles?
Architectural shingles, often called dimensional tiles, are a prominent roof option for property owners seeking both design and toughness. Unlike standard 3-tab roof shingles, building roof shingles feature a split layout that creates a distinctive appearance. This included measurement not only enhances your home's aesthetic appeal yet likewise imitates the look of extra costly products, such as wood or slate.

Additionally, building roof shingles flaunt a longer life expectancy compared to typical choices, making them a smart investment. Their weight and density offer extra defense against wind and rain, offering you satisfaction. When you choose architectural tiles, you're integrating visual appeals with useful advantages for your home.

Setup Strategies Review
With your preparation and planning complete, it's time to focus on the installation methods for architectural roof shingles. Begin by putting down a water resistant underlayment to shield versus dampness. Beginning at the eaves, positioning tiles in overlapping rows, guaranteeing they're straightened effectively. Make use of a chalk line to keep straight sides. Secure each roof shingles with 4 nails, finding them below the adhesive strip to stop water penetration. Stagger the seams in between rows for extra toughness and a much more attractive appearance. As you reach the ridge, use hip and ridge tiles to develop a completed look. Check your job for any kind of gaps or loosened roof shingles, making certain everything is watertight and safe and secure. Appropriate installation not just improves visual appeals yet also lasts much longer.
Maintenance Tips for Architectural Roofing Shingles
To keep your architectural tiles in top form, routine maintenance is vital. Start by inspecting your roof covering at the very least two times a year, specifically after extreme weather. Seek loosened or broken shingles, in addition to any type of indicators of algae or moss growth. If you detect any type of issues, resolve them immediately to stop further damage.
Next, clean your rain gutters regularly to guarantee proper water drainage. Clogged Click Here gutters can result in water pooling on your roofing system, which can hurt your roof shingles in time. You can likewise gently wash your shingles with a mixture of water and mild cleaning agent to get why not check here rid of dust and algae, however prevent high-pressure washing, as it can dislodge tiles.
Ultimately, take into consideration cutting looming branches to stop debris accumulation and allow sunshine to dry your roofing. By complying with these simple actions, you'll aid prolong the life of your architectural shingles and keep your home's visual appeal.

Cost Contrast Analysis
While you might be drawn to the visual appeal of building shingles, it's necessary to examine how their expenses compare to various other roofing products. Generally, building shingles fall in the mid-range rate classification, setting you back between $90 and $100 per square. On the other hand, traditional 3-tab roof shingles are more affordable, balancing $70 to $80 per square. Metal roofing, on the various other hand, can vary from $100 to $300 per square, depending on the products used. If you're thinking about tile roofing, that can set you back $300 or more per square. Evaluating these prices versus the lifespan and maintenance demands of each option can help you make a more informed decision that straightens with your spending plan and visual choices.
Durability and Resilience
Expense is simply one element to consider in your roofing choice; longevity and toughness play necessary roles too (architectural shingles). Building shingles commonly last 25 to three decades, outperforming conventional asphalt shingles, which may just offer you around 15 to 20 years. Their multi-layered design boosts their strength, making them a lot more immune to extreme climate condition, consisting of wind and hailstorm
When you contrast them to steel roof, which can last as much as half a century, architectural tiles could appear less sturdy. Nevertheless, they provide a wonderful equilibrium of price and longevity. Inevitably, picking building shingles suggests purchasing a dependable alternative that stands the test of time, ensuring your home stays protected without requiring regular replacements.

Can I Set Up Architectural Shingles Over My Existing Roof?
You can install building roof shingles over your existing roofing system, but validate the existing roofing is in good problem. Inspect local building regulations, as some locations require a tear-off for proper air flow and structural integrity.
Do Architectural Tiles Require Unique Tools for Installment?
You don't need unique devices for mounting architectural shingles, yet having a few important items like a roof nailer, an utility blade, and a ladder will make the procedure smoother and a lot more efficient.
